Bird’s eye view of Pannonhalma

Created: 1875

Description: Two neo-classical architects, J. F. Engel and Packh, fashioned the library, tower, and elements of Pannonhalma’s monumental façade. They filled in the space between the fortress walls, leaving only the outer castle wall. The service building seen in 18th-century depictions is still standing in this picture as well on the south side between the two corner towers. In 1939 the secondary school was built in its place.
